PROCEDURE
INSTALL COOLER CONDENSER ASSEMBLY
Engage the 2 guides to install the cooler condenser assembly.
Note
Do not damage the cooler condenser assembly or radiator when installing the cooler condenser assembly.
Tech Tips
If a new cooler condenser assembly is installed, add compressor oil to the cooler condenser assembly as follows.
| Capacity |
|---|
| Add 40 cc (1.35 fl. oz.) |
| Compressor oil |
|---|
| for HFC-134a (R134a) |
| ND-OIL 8 or equivalent |
| for HFO-1234yf (R1234yf) |
| ND-OIL 12 or equivalent |
Engage the 2 claws.
INSTALL RADIATOR UPPER SUPPORT SUB-ASSEMBLY
Install the radiator upper support sub-assembly with the 4 bolts.
Engage the 2 clamps to install the hood lock control cable sub-assembly.
Engage the 2 clamps to install the wire harness.
Connect the connector.
CONNECT LIQUID PIPE SUB-ASSEMBLY (for HFC-134a(R134a))
Remove the attached vinyl tape from the liquid pipe sub-assembly and the connecting part of the cooler condenser assembly.
Apply sufficient compressor oil to a new O-ring and the fitting surface of the tube joint.
| Compressor oil |
|---|
| ND-OIL 8 or equivalent |
Install the O-ring onto the liquid pipe sub-assembly.
Install the liquid pipe sub-assembly onto the cooler condenser assembly with the bolt.
CONNECT COOLER REFRIGERANT LIQUID PIPE A (for HFO-1234yf(R1234yf))
Remove the attached vinyl tape from the cooler refrigerant liquid pipe A and the connecting part of the cooler condenser.
Apply sufficient compressor oil to a new O-ring and the fitting surface of the tube joint.
| Compressor oil |
|---|
| ND-OIL 12 or equivalent |
Install the O-ring onto the cooler refrigerant liquid pipe A.
Install the cooler refrigerant liquid pipe A onto the cooler condenser with the bolt.
CONNECT NO. 1 COOLER REFRIGERANT DISCHARGE HOSE
Remove the attached vinyl tape from the No. 1 cooler refrigerant discharge hose and the connecting part of the cooler condenser assembly.
Apply sufficient compressor oil to a new O-ring and the fitting surface of the hose joint.
| Compressor oil |
|---|
| for HFC-134a (R134a) |
| ND-OIL 8 or equivalent |
| for HFO-1234yf (R1234yf) |
| ND-OIL 12 or equivalent |
Install the O-ring onto the No. 1 cooler refrigerant discharge hose.
Install the No. 1 cooler refrigerant discharge hose onto the cooler condenser assembly with the bolt.
INSTALL NO. 1 COOLER COVER
Engage the 2 guides to install the No. 1 cooler cover.
